LOL I altered it in PS using a number of FloraBella actions, Halo and Sublime. That gave it a great glow! 

Taking a white doily that I had on hand, I've used Coffee Shop Glimmer Mist to alter the white color a bit. My Dusty Attic piece was simply inked with my Ranger Distress Ink in Vintage Photo. Although they are hard to see, I added in some small brown pearls to give it a  bit of pizazz. 

Then I began layering in a number of Petaloo and Prima florals as well as the Prima resin bridge. My Prima branch is an older one called Cherry Blossoms in the Jubilee color.  The Petaloo are from the Canterbury collection .. love those!!  Some are the Glittered Fleur and some are the plain. My title is merely some Glitz tiny alphas in Navy mounted on a Glitz French Kiss die cut.  Butterflies are courtesy of Lisa Gregory (thanks, Lisa!) and printed on white card stock.  I love printing them out and adding a bit of Clear Rock Candy to them as well as a few pearls and popping them up on foam squares. Because I did not plan quite right, I had to replace regular stitching with my Tim Holtz stamp in 2 corners. Alas, I had tape right where I had wanted to do my stitching. Oh, well, next time!
